Who discovered mutual inductance independently of Joseph Henry?

  • Thomas Edison

  • Nikola Tesla

  • Michael Faraday

  • Marie Curie

Answer

Michael Faraday discovered mutual inductance independently of Joseph Henry in 1831. He was able to demonstrate that a changing current in one circuit could induce a current in a nearby circuit. This principle is used in many electrical devices, such as transformers and motors.
